Roland Launches Masters Program
Since the beginning, Roland has attracted highly skilled, creative professionals whose graphics are rapidly redefining the industry.

To celebrate our 25th anniversary, we launched the Roland Masters program, recognizing the artistic and technical achievements of outstanding customers. Roland Masters have been selected from a range of industries that reflect our broad market reach. Each Master has extensive experience with Roland’s award-winning inkjet printers and integrated printer/cutters and all have selected Roland equipment based on its superior engineering, reliability and performance.

Throughout 2006, these industry visionaries will appear in Roland advertisements, trade magazine articles, on our Web site and at events nationwide. To date, the Roland Masters Program has recognized the following professionals:
